#81c4fb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#81c4fb is composed of 50.6% red, 76.9%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.6% cyan, 21.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 207 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 74.5%. #81c4fb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0389f7.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#81c4fb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#81c4fb has RGB values of R:129, G:196,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 8504571.

Shades and Tints of #81c4fb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000407 is the darkest color, while #f3f9ff is the lightest one.
